On April 05, 2022, the Islamic Organization for Food Security (IOFS) representatives visited the Aerospace industry of the Republic of Kazakhstan (Kazakhstan Gharysh Sapary -KGS) to discuss establishing a satellite-based agricultural database and monitoring system.

A team of IOFS, headed by Director General H.E. Yerlan Baidaulet, Director of Programs and Project Office Dr. Ismail Abdelhamid, and Program Manager A H M Kamruzzaman attended the bilateral meeting with the Chairman of KGS, as well as other experts from the Aerospace Committee, Kazakhstan Gharysh Sapary (KGS). 
An in-depth discussion on how to monitor surface water resources, crops, forests, floods, land use, and what is applied to agricultural research was presented by the expert team of the Aerospace industry of the Republic of Kazakhstan.
H.E. Yerlan Baidaulet, Director General of IOFS, noted that cooperation with the KGS in all areas covering food security would strengthen with a particular focus on the IOFS Year of Africa program to support African member states of IOFS.
During the meeting, Mr. Aidyn Aimbetov proposed to monitor the drought-affected area, surface water, and transboundary pests (locusts) of African countries.
Following the meeting, the parties agreed to develop a satellite based agricultural database and build a better prediction system for agriculture.
